To appreciate the requirement of preserving wall drain, one should understand the forces at play. Soil behind a maintaining wall applies stress on the framework, called lateral planet pressure. This stress enhances when water gathers, as water logged dirt evaluates even more and applies added force on the wall.

Weep openings are little openings through the wall surface that allow water to get away from behind the structure.
